## Service Account: fuelrep-svc

The fleet fuel-usage report at Korvane Logistics runs nightly via the fuelrep-svc account. Scope: read-only access to the TankLedger aggregation API. No interactive login; rotation every 90 days. Audit logs ship to the Veldmark SIEM. Reviewer note: access limited to the Drayton depot dataset. The key currently in use is listed below.

gateway credential: qvz3-w0y

**Audit item 14: Turnstile counter sanity check.** Before each home match at Varnwick Field, compare the GateCount reading on turnstile bank C against the steward tally sheet. Anything off by more than 2% gets flagged — don't just shrug it off, it happens more than you'd think. Log discrepancies and ping the owner below.

named custodian: Brivan Eliath Quenox Frador

/*
 * Polling interval for the Harwick partner SFTP drop.
 * Harwick uploads nightly batches between 01:00 and 03:00
 * local time; polling faster than this just burns connection
 * slots on their side and triggers their rate limiter. If the
 * drop looks empty past 04:00, escalate to the integrations
 * channel. The expected batch build marker appears below.
 */

session token of yahof-bajeg = htk9_0d43d44ed

Key ceremony checklist — Retryloom idempotency signing key. Plugin authors: after the new key is cut, every retry you send must carry an idempotency key signed with it, or Quillpay will bounce the charge. Before you leave the ceremony, record the rollback credential. Write down the recovery passphrase shown just below.

unlock words, hafop-tahog: drumir-druiel-kasox-wenax-tamys-frair